I finally have my boobies !

First I want to thank all of you girls for all the support and knowledge, I fell so calm and prepared for my surgery because of this great forum.
My surgery was yesterday the 29. I arrived at the hospital at 6 am, and I had to wait in the waiting room. Then I was taken into another room with my mom and aunt. There I had to change into the robe. From there the nurse came and went over my health and history again and then put the IV in and it hurted so much. From there another doctor came to go over my health again and make sure that I was fine and took my blood preassure (which was normal thank God). From there I was taken to to the surgery waiting room. I gave my mom and aunt a hug, and left. I have to say that was the hardest part for me.
I was taken to another room where I met the nurse that would be taking care of me during the surgery. She was super nice and made me feel more calm. After that I met my anestheciologist and he was hillarious and went over my health history again and made me sign some papers.
From there my PS came in and told me not to worry that everything was going to be fine. He drew on me and took some pictures. After that my nurse and anestheciologist took me in the strecher to the surgery room, and I was a little freaked out of the surgical room, but the anestheciologist gave me the anesthecia and after that I don't remember anything else.
After I woke up in the recovery room and the first thing I said was "I need my mommy", they were really nice and they called my mom and she went and saw me and then left. I was still somewhat sleepy from the anesthecia. My nurse came in and told me everything had gone great and that I looked like a barbie !!!
After I was taking to the room with my mom and aunt and I was still somewhat sleepy and I felt nauseus but the nurse gave me something and I haven't felt nauseus again. I finally left the hospital at 3 pm when I felt stronger. I have to say that the hospital treatment was great and they were super nice.
Today I went to see my surgeon and he told me that I was fine just really swollen that it would go down. I'm not so much in pain and I feel better.
